About this property

Hiking, mt biking, 44 acres to explore, 20 min outside of Santa Fe

The peaceful, quiet, serenity of this property invites rest, relaxation, and rejuvenation. Ski Santa Fe 45 min. Taos Ski Valley 2- hour drive. Epic mountain bike trails 5 minutes away. Many hiking trails nearby and walking trails throughout the property. Enjoy views of the foothills of the Sangre De Cristo mountains from every room. This 1650sq. ft. home includes a well- stocked kitchen with island which opens to the living area with a kiva fireplace, and dining area which seats 4-6 people. Relax on the patio and gas firepit area. Sacred sculptures can be seen at various locations along the trails which were donated to the property. There is also a community pond to enjoy.
Just 20 minutes from Santa Fe, restaurants, galleries, and restaurants. Within minutes of fishing, pueblo and Civil War sites. Experience the Santa Fe Opera, botanical garden, or Casinos. We can get some snow in the winter, so a 4 wheel or AWD is recommended from December through March. Ask me if you’re needing more space. We have a 2 bedroom 1 bath up the road.

Why they chose this property

We bought the Old Glorieta Pass Ranch in 2010, divided it into seven lots. We kept 2 of the lots. My house was built by my son and a small crew in the typical northern New Mexico style, using traditional adobe construction with “tin” roof, lintels above the doors and windows, and plaster walls. Notice the bits of straw in the plaster. It took two years to build the house. There are 3 small houses on this family lot.
Our 2nd lot has the beginning phase of a sacred garden. The life size sculptures were donated to the property. To honor this gift, we are creating 3 areas on the 22 acres, with trails leading to each site and connecting the garden.
